Вопросы по теме 'visualworks'

Как я могу запустить VisualWorks под OpenBSD?
Кто-нибудь запускал VisualWorks под OpenBSD? Это официально не поддерживаемая платформа, но один из ребят из Cincom сказал мне, что она должна работать в режиме совместимости с Linux. Как вы это настроили? У меня уже работает Squeak без проблем,...
491 просмотров
schedule 18.03.2023

Как избавиться от неуправляемого кода в VW 3.1d и ENVY
У меня есть старый образ VW3/ENVY с посылкой, загруженной как неуправляемый код (именно такая ситуация Mastering ENVY/DEVELOPER предупреждает об этом). К сожалению, эта проблема случилась давно и уже поздно просто "вернуться" к изображению без...
77 просмотров
schedule 17.12.2022

Smalltalk - преобразование текстового объекта в строку
Привет, у меня есть виджет текстового редактора в smalltalk (визуальные работы), который возвращает текстовый объект, однако я хочу, чтобы возвращаемый текст обрабатывался как строковый объект. Как вы анализируете текстовый объект как строку?
956 просмотров
schedule 30.07.2022

Распределенный контроль версий для VisualWorks Smalltalk
Одна из раздражающих особенностей Smalltalk заключается в том, что ему (обычно) требуется собственная система контроля версий из-за того, как он управляет своим исходным кодом. Squeak и Gemstone (по крайней мере, в версии GLASS) имеют DVCS под...
295 просмотров
schedule 30.05.2023

Как передать файлы Smalltalk между компьютерами?
Мне нужно передать несколько файлов Smalltalk между двумя разными компьютерами, на которых работает Cincom VisualWorks. (Я не уверен, имеет ли это значение, но один из них — машина с Windows 7, а другой — Mac). Как передать свой проект? Должен ли я...
455 просмотров
schedule 27.06.2022

assert терпит неудачу, когда не должен, в тестовом примере Smalltalk Unit
Я в тупике. Вот мой тесткейс. theTestArray := #(1.2 3 5.1 7). self assert: theTestArray squareOfAllElements = #(1.44 9 26.01 49). Утверждение не должно терпеть неудачу. При расчете площади каждого элемента правильно. Итак, я сделал «шаг в...
553 просмотров

Разбор RDF в Smalltalk
Есть ли какой-либо пример в любой разновидности Smalltalk, показывающий, как анализировать файл RDF? Единственный пакет, который я видел, это Rikaiko с классом RDFXMLReader, но на него нет ссылок, и он кажется очень недокументированным.
354 просмотров
schedule 27.07.2022

Smalltalk не распознает объявленные временные переменные
Так что я совсем новичок, когда дело доходит до Smalltalk, и сейчас я пишу очень простое приложение с графическим интерфейсом. Все, что делает это приложение, — складывает вместе два операнда из двух полей ввода и отображает сумму в третьем поле...
165 просмотров
schedule 13.02.2023

Использование SelectionInList с SortedCollection?
Используя Visualworks (Cincom Smalltalk) и виджет List, как можно использовать SortedCollection вместе с SelectionInList? Например, как мне инициализировать SelectionInList с помощью SortedCollection? Я запутался в этом процессе и не могу найти...
173 просмотров
schedule 24.04.2022

Совместное использование сессий на море с помощью Gemstone/S
Я пишу веб-приложение, используя VisualWorks Smalltalk, Seaside и Gemstone/S. На данный момент состояние сеанса для клиента может поддерживаться только в том случае, если клиент всегда возвращается к одному и тому же образу (хотя, если сеанс...
147 просмотров
schedule 16.04.2022

Исходный код отсутствует в Cincom VIsualWorks 7.9.1 в Windows 8
Я использую Cincom VisualWorks версии 7.9.1 в Windows 8. Когда я открываю браузер классов и просматриваю библиотечный класс, он не отображает исходный код, вместо этого отображается комментарий об ошибке, подобный этому: " ***This is...
449 просмотров
schedule 30.03.2023

Smalltalk Как создать неизменяемую переменную экземпляра?
У меня есть класс с переменной экземпляра var. Я не хочу, чтобы переменная изменялась/присваивалась значение, за исключением случаев, когда объект создается с использованием метода класса. isImmutable: aBoolean — это метод преобразования...
376 просмотров
schedule 06.12.2022

Уничтожение переменных класса Visualworks Cincom Smalltalk
Как мы можем инициализировать переменную класса в Visualworks Smalltalk и уничтожить ее после использования? Я хочу знать о ClassVariables. НЕ ClassInstanceVariables. Я реализую шаблон Singleton, и вот мой код MyClass class>>...
169 просмотров

Преобразование строки и целого числа в шестнадцатеричный в smalltalk
TL;DR: как преобразовать целые числа в шестнадцатеричные, а также как преобразовать строку из 1 символа в шестнадцатеричный (например, 'F' -> 0xF ) хотите преобразовать символ в шестнадцатеричное значение, сделайте некоторую математику, а затем...
1240 просмотров
schedule 10.04.2023

Как показать коллекцию изображений в графическом интерфейсе VisualWorks Smalltalk
Я хочу загрузить коллекцию изображений и показать их в графическом интерфейсе, например, в Instagram или что-то в этом роде. Как мне это сделать? Какой виджет мне следует использовать? Я пытался создать ViewHolder в графический интерфейс, но я не...
238 просмотров
schedule 06.10.2022

светская беседа: как превратить int в строку его шестнадцатеричного значения? (изобразительные работы)
TL;DR : как сложить вместе 4 числа и сохранить ответ в виде строки, представляющей шестнадцатеричное значение (например, 10+5, сохраненное как «F», или 2+1, сохраненное как «3 ") . Об этом уже спрашивали ЗДЕСЬ, но ни один из ответов не...
197 просмотров
schedule 02.06.2023

Пытаетесь найти строку во всем классе Smalltalk VisualWorks?
Я пытаюсь создать небольшую функцию для поиска строки во всем приложении. Я получил этот код, но он не сильно поможет aString := '\\'. class := DosFileDirectory. methodsContainingString := class methodDictionary values select: [:method |...
286 просмотров
schedule 21.06.2023

Как ввести символ «флажок» в pdf-файл, сгенерированный report4pdf?
Поэтому я работаю над созданием PDF-файлов с помощью пакета report4PDF (bob nemec) из программного обеспечения VisualWorks 8.1 от Cincom. Я делаю все в «светской беседе». Однако сейчас проблема, с которой я сталкиваюсь, заключается в том, что я не...
456 просмотров
schedule 04.05.2023

Обязательные атрибуты в Smalltalk
Я пишу курсы на Pharo Smalltalk, но полагаю, что этот вопрос актуален и для других реализаций Smalltalk. Я знаю способ принудительного применения экземпляров с определенными атрибутами — предоставить метод класса для создания экземпляра, а затем...
236 просмотров

Индексы подстроки в Smalltalk
Кажется, что в реализациях Smalltalk отсутствует алгоритм, который возвращает все индексы подстроки в строке. Наиболее похожие возвращают только один индекс элемента, например: firstIndexesOf:in:, findSubstring:, findAnySubstring: варианты. В Ruby...
740 просмотров